Hi folks.. My Mk1 (1999) Octavia needs the headlights changed. It has the really old ones, the ones with all the directional lines in the glass.. I can't seem to get any of these, and I'm wondering, do the next generation ones fit straight in?? The ones that are clear glass, from abt 2001??

 

Thanks..

 

The original Octavia and facelift models have slightly different shaped headlamps.  I discovered this when I bought a set of pre-FL lamps for my FL mk1 and they wouldn't fit :(
